How do you get a job in..?
The retail sector is one of the country's biggest employers, with an estimated three million people working in thousands of shops across the UK.
Some companies have had a hard time during the economic downturn, with big names disappearing from the High Street, but others are growing and taking on new staff.
Jo Mackie, who is head of recruitment for Superdrug, the beauty chain with more than 900 stores, says it is important to work hard and seize every opportunity.
